This genus is not in use as it is currently considered to be a junior synonym of Nesomyrmex.
Nomenclature
The following information is derived from Barry Bolton's Online Catalogue of the Ants of the World.
- IRENEOPONE [junior synonym of Nesomyrmex]
- Ireneopone Donisthorpe, 1946d: 242. Type-species: Ireneopone gibber, by original designation.
- Ireneopone junior synonym of Nesomyrmex: Bolton, 2003: 250, 272.
